How is the pulsation torque of a universal motor minimised?

A single-phase motor provides a torque which pulsates at double the supply frequency. The effect is reduced by the moment of inertia of the rotating parts of the motor. If it is still excessive for a particular application, a flywheel can be placed on the shaft.


Why are moving iron test instruments not used with DC although they can work in DC?

For moving-iron instrument magnetic field is caused when the current (voltage) passes the fixed circle. When the current (voltage) passes the fixed circle,the two iron plates are magnetized ,rotational torque is resulted, the deflection angle indicate measured current. Because the magnetized polarity is same for AC or DC, moving-iron instrument can be used in AC and DC circuit. For permanent-magnet moving-coil instrument magnetic field is caused by the permanent-magnet, When the DC current passes the moving coil, rotational torque is resulted,so the deflection angle indicate measured DC current. As AC current passes the moving coil ,because inertia of moving parts of meter the deflection angle indicate rotational torque average, but rotational torque average is zero in cycle, moving parts of meter is´t deflec,so permanent-magnet moving-coil instrument only is used in DC circuit.

What are the functions of the engineers transit parts?

There are many parts that make up an engineer's transit. The three main groups are the leveling head which is telescopic, lower plate which clamps, and the upper plate which levels the view.
